Conversion Therapy for LGBTQ Youth Banned by Michigan Governor

LANSING, Mich. (AP) — Michigan joins the growing list of states that have outlawed conversion therapy for minors with the signing of new legislation by Governor Gretchen Whitmer. The practice of conversion therapy, which seeks to change an individual’s sexual orientation or gender identity, has been scientifically discredited. 16 Individuals Charged With Felonies as ‘False Electors’

The “false electors” in Michigan who attempted to overturn President Biden’s 2020 election victory are now facing real criminal charges. On Tuesday, State Attorney General Dana Nessel announced that the 16 Republicans involved have been charged with eight felonies, including conspiracy to commit election law forgery, as reported by the Detroit News. Only One State Remains with a Cohabitation Ban

UPDATE Jul 18, 2023 12:58 PM CDT Michigan Governor Gretchen Whitmer has signed a legislation that allows unmarried couples to live together.
